Co₁Cu₂Ge₁S₄ is a quaternary chalcogenide semiconductor compound combining cobalt, copper, germanium, and sulfur elements. This material belongs to the family of mixed-metal sulfides and represents an experimental composition of interest in solid-state chemistry and materials research, rather than an established commercial product. Its potential applications lie in photovoltaic devices, thermoelectric energy conversion, and optoelectronic components where mixed-valence metal sulfides offer tunable band gaps and mixed ionic-electronic conductivity.
